1.  Seest thou one who denies the Judgment (to come)?

2.  Then such is the (man) who repulses the orphan (with harshness),

3.  and encourages not the feeding of the indigent.

4.  So woe to the worshipers

5.  who are neglectful of their Prayers,

6.  Those who (want but) to be seen (of men),

7.  But refuse (to supply) (even) neighborly needs.

People of the Religion of Islam are supposed to be generous and do their best to help the needy.  They are also supposed to pray fervently.  Those that do not pray fervently and those that make no attempt to help those in need are condemned.
